|    Login    |    Register

Filter Results

  • Large print only
  • Audiobooks only

Found 5 items


(Paperback)

By: Jonathan Haskel

ISBN: 9780691241098
Readership/Audience: General
Publication Date: Apr 2022
Publisher: Princeton University Press
See more...


(Hardback)

By: Jonathan Haskel

ISBN: 9780691211589
Readership/Audience: Tertiary Education
Publication Date: Jun 2022
Publisher: Princeton University Press
See more...


(Hardback)

By: Jonathan Haskel

ISBN: 9780691175034
Readership/Audience: Tertiary Education
Publication Date: Feb 2018
Publisher: Princeton University Press
See more...


(Paperback)

By: Jonathan Haskel

ISBN: 9780691183299
Readership/Audience: Tertiary Education
Publication Date: Jan 2019
Publisher: Princeton University Press
See more...


(Paperback)

By: Jonathan Haskel

ISBN: 9780691236032
Readership/Audience: Tertiary Education
Publication Date: Jan 2024
Publisher: Princeton University Press
See more...